Output 8081cfb2168711119462078060e46e9e985a6b758013bfec6b2c794f7ba961d8:3

value
28405846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a2a7af9f3186ecd63f020ef14bb45bb6529ab12 OP_EQUAL
address
3CpyFY1DcCSx32zamF9VwwTTmbwTCNSotJ
transaction
8081cfb2168711119462078060e46e9e985a6b758013bfec6b2c794f7ba961d8
confirmations
355425
spent
true